作 者:胥楠[1] 陈晓理[1] 芦灵军[1] 次仁桑珠[1]
机构地区:[1]四川大学华西医学中心附属华西医院,四川成都610041
出 处:《中国中药杂志》2005年第18期1441-1443,共3页China Journal of Chinese Materia Medica
基 金:国家自然科学基金资助项目(39970932)
摘 要:目的:观察大黄治疗组和正常组小鼠肠道免疫分泌物的变化;探讨大黄对肠道黏膜屏障保护作用的机制。方法:实验用BALB/c小鼠。分成生理盐水灌胃组和10%大黄煎剂灌胃组。24h后处死动物,灌洗肠道,收集灌洗液,分别测定IgA、总蛋白、补体C3、高密度脂蛋白(HDL)、Ⅱ型磷脂酶A2(PLA2)活力和溶菌酶的含量;同时切取并收集各小鼠小肠组织40mg,运用RT-PCR扩增,琼脂糖凝胶电泳成像检测隐窝素-1基因和隐窝素-4基因扩增片段含量。结果:2组小肠灌洗液中IgA,总蛋白,补体C3,溶菌酶含量以及Ⅱ型PLA2活力有统计学差别(P<0.05)。2组小肠灌洗液中HDL含量无统计学差别(P>0.05)。2组小肠组织匀浆中隐窝素-1(Cr1)基因扩增片段含量与隐窝素-4(Cr4)基因扩增片段含量无统计学差别(P>0.05)。结论:大黄能促进肠黏膜上皮分泌多种免疫相关物质,对于减轻创伤、烧伤、休克等严重应激反应时的肠黏膜损伤,防止肠道菌群移位和全身炎症反应综合征的发生具有重要的理论和临床意义。Objective: To investigate the therapeutic mechanism of rhubarb in protecting the intestinal muco-membranous barrier in the mice. Method. Bal b/c mice were divided into 2 groups, gavaged with normal saline and 10% rhubarb decoction, respectively. The animals were killed after 24 hours after the treatments. The intestinal juice was collected after intestinal lavage and centrifuged for determination of IgA, total protein, C3, high density lipoprotein, type Ⅱ PLA2 activity, and content of lysozyme. At the same time, 40 mg of small intestine were incised in each mouse.Reverse transcription polymerase chain reaction (RT-PCR) and gel image analysis were performed to detect the content of the cryptdin gene expression. Result: The content of IgA, total protein, the C3, lysozyme, and the type Ⅱ PIA2 activity in intestinal lavaged juice exhibited the statistical differences between the two groups( P 〈 0.05). There were no significant difference in the ontents of HDL, cryptdin-1 and cryptdin-4 gene expression between the two groups ( P 〉 0.05). Conclusion: Rhubarb could increase secretion of several immune associated substances of the mucous membrane in normal intestine, indicating a possibility to abate the injury of intestine mucus resulted from severe stress induced by trauma,bum and shock. Through above mechanisms Rhubarb may also reduce the incidence of bacterial translocation and systemic inflammatory reaction syndrome (SIRS),
